Thursday 7/18/2019 BIg Brother 21 Live Feed Spoilers and Updates!!!

And another relatively quiet day passed in the old BB house. Sam counseled Nicole on what to say to try and stay in the house. His advice, tell Christie you're targeting Jack and Jackson so she'll want to keep you. Bad advice Sam. Nicole will be smarter to just keep her mouth shut today and let things play out. Which I think she'll do.

 

The Gr8ful/H8ful alliance will officially end tonight with the blindside of Sam, Nick and Witchabella. We'll lose one more decent person from the game in Cliff and keep more idiots who are hard to root for. Right now Camp Comeback and Cliff/Nicole comprise the more or less easy to root for people in the game. (I'll squeeze Kat into that group also, but I'm not really sure Kat knows she's playing Big Brother.)

Saturday's POV comp will likely be very hard fought as everyone will be fearful of Christie's ability to turn the Golden POV into the Diamond POV. If you hold the POV, you pretty much take away her power. All she could do then is take someone down, but you could then put someone else up and with her having lots of allies, there would still be multiple good targets. If say Jack and Christie were the nominees, Christie pulled herself off using the prize, then the POV holder would put up the replacement. If POV holder is someone outside of Christie's alliance that person could be Tommy or Jackson. ff it's someone inside Christie's alliance that person could be Nick, Sam, Witchabella with Christie's side having the votes to evict them. No one should throw any POV as long as Christie holds that power.
